Understanding Emergency Weather Damage Mitigation
Severe weather conditions can occur suddenly, leaving property owners distressed and vulnerable to significant damage. Emergency weather damage mitigation is a crucial process that involves taking immediate action to reduce the impact of weather-related incidents like storms, floods, and heavy snowfall. This proactive approach can significantly lessen damage, support recovery, and safeguard your property.

Steps to Take for Effective Emergency Weather Damage Mitigation
1. Prepare Your Property in Advance
Inspect and Maintain Your Assets
Regular inspections and maintenance can help you identify vulnerabilities in your property. Assess your roof, windows, and doors and make necessary repairs to fortify your home against extreme weather.
Create an Emergency Plan
Develop a comprehensive emergency response plan that includes:
- Emergency contacts
- Evacuation routes
- Safe meeting points
- Locations of emergency supplies
2. Immediate Actions During a Weather Event
Secure Loose Objects
Before a storm or heavy winds, secure or bring inside any outdoor furniture, decorations, or equipment that could become airborne and cause damage.
Ensure Proper Drainage
Make sure that gutters and downspouts are clear of debris, allowing for efficient water drainage during heavy rains. This reduces the risk of flooding and water damage.
3. Post-Weather Event Actions
Assess Damage Promptly
As soon as it is safe, examine your property for any damage. Document the extent of the damage with photographs and notes, which will be essential for insurance claims and recovery efforts.
Contact Emergency Response Services
Engaging emergency storm damage repair specialists quickly is essential for alleviating further destruction. They can help assess the status of your property and begin the restoration process.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is Emergency Weather Damage Mitigation?
Emergency weather damage mitigation refers to immediate actions taken to reduce the impact of severe weather on properties. This involves preemptive measures and responsive actions during and after a weather-related incident.
How Can I Prepare My Home for Severe Weather?
A few effective steps include reinforcing windows and doors, maintaining your roof and gutters, securing outdoor items, and creating an emergency plan with family members.
What Should I Do Immediately After Severe Weather Hits?
First, ensure the safety of all occupants. Next, assess any property damage and document it for insurance purposes. Finally, reach out to qualified professionals for emergency storm damage repair services.
Can I Handle Emergency Weather Damage Mitigation Myself?
While some initial mitigation actions can be performed by homeowners, such as securing loose items and clearing gutters, it is recommended to contact specialists for significant damage assessments and repairs.
